MARGARET KATHLEEN (KAY) AKINS nee JENNINGS Died very peacefully in her sleep at Grace Hospital (Winnipeg) at 2:45 a.m., September 4, 2003, two days after her 100th birthday. Married in 1927 to Col. E.J.W. Akins, RCE, P. Engineer (Retd), who predeceased her in 1977. Together again at long last in Chapel Lawn Memorial Gardens. A woman of quiet faith and good heart, ever gracious and accommodating, who lived for her husband and her family. She set an example for her sons, which was often striven for but never attained. Predeceased by her son Melvin (1956) grandson Brian Patrick (1961) her parents Barnabas (1957) and Elinore (1966) her sister Frances Clearwater; her brother Ernie Boyle; and by many, many staunch true friends. Survived and mourned by her sons and daughters-in-law, George (Carol), Brian (Shirley), Bill (Doreen) her grandchildren, Kathleen (Martin), Bruce (Chris), Clive and Susan (Gary) and her great-grandchildren, Evin and Allison Akins, and Majka and Lev Akins Hahn. In earlier years, Kay Akins was active in the Crescent Fort Rouge United Church, Deer Lodge United Church, the Twelfth Fd. Co. RCE Womens Auxiliary, the Engineers Wives and the Valour Road Curling Club. By her express instruction a private cremation will be held at once with a memorial service to be held later at a place and date to be announced. Held dear in life and death.
